What is the Supervisor's Injury Investigation Strain Supplement Form?

The Supervisor's Injury Investigation Strain Supplement Form is designed to document incidents involving back injuries, suspected hernias, or other strains reported by employees in Florida. This form serves as a crucial component in the employee injury management process by clarifying the circumstances around the injury. It is essential for developing a thorough understanding of strain incidents, helping employers ensure compliance with Florida regulations regarding injury reporting.
This form is integral to effectively managing employee injuries. By accurately documenting the details of the incident, both employers and employees benefit from enhanced clarity and organized records, which are vital for any necessary follow-up actions.

Field-by-Field Instructions for Completing the Form

Each section of the Supervisor's Injury Investigation Strain Supplement Form requires specific information. Here are essential fields to focus on:
  • Employee's personal details: Ensure accurate spelling and current information.
  • Date and time of the incident: Document this clearly to establish a timeline.
  • Description of the injury: Provide detailed accounts of symptoms and circumstances.
  • Witness information: Include any individuals who observed the incident.
Adhering to these instructions will help minimize common mistakes, ensuring all critical information is captured for a thorough investigation.
